Your Mission:
We are seeking a motivated Software Engineer III to join a team supporting data analytics development. This developer will work directly with stakeholders to gather requirements, design and deploy advanced analytics, and create solutions that automate and enhance data and metadata analysis across multiple tools.
You will excel in this role if you are:
Fluent in Java and comfortable writing complex code to automate analytical queries Able to translate analyst needs into scalable and maintainable technical solutions Comfortable working directly with analysts and stakeholders Interested in developing analytics that summarize, enrich, and transform raw data Experienced building solutions that support real-time or batch search operations Someone who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ative, mission-focused environment A day in the life consists of:
Collaborating with analysts to understand operational goals and data artifacts Designing and deploying Java-based analytics to automate search and data workflows Leveraging multiple data sources to enhance understanding of user activities Enriching and summarizing data for downstream analytics and decision making Delivering scalable, reusable code that meets mission performance standards Iterating quickly based on real-world analyst feedback Must haves:
TS/SCI clearance with polygraph 8+ years of relevant software engineering experience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field (or 4 additional years of relevant SWE experience) Strong Java development skills Experience with Pig, Query Time Analytics, and artifact-based development Comfortable working closely with analysts to define, iterate, and deliver solutions Nice to have:
Familiarity with corporate tools and data repositories Programming experience with Python Experience developing analytics across multiple large datasets Background in automating search patterns and intelligence workflows Understanding of data enrichment and metadata structuring techniques
